Olivia Attwood has openly criticised her own engagement to footballer Bradley Dack, labelling the romantic moment as 'vomit inducing' because of its stereotypical beach setting in Dubai. The television personality, aged thirty-four, made these candid remarks during a recent podcast episode, just weeks after publicly announcing the end of their nearly three-year marriage in January.
Awkward Proposal Discussion Amid Marriage Breakdown
During a conversation on her podcast, Olivia's House, with guest Amy Jackson, Olivia was unexpectedly asked about her proposal experience. She appeared willing to discuss the topic but admitted that her perspective has drastically changed since the couple's separation. Olivia revealed that the proposal occurred on a Dubai beach, a location she now finds overly cliche and unappealing.
'If I See One More Burj Al Arab Engagement, I'll Vomit'
Olivia elaborated on her feelings, stating, 'Don't judge me, I think we were one of the first couples on my Instagram to do Dubai on the beach. Now if someone did Dubai on the beach I'd say no, because it's just... if I see one more Burj Al Arab engagement, I'll vomit.' She acknowledged that at the time, she enjoyed the surprise and the celebration, but emphasised that her current view is markedly different.

Infidelity Allegations and Emotional Turmoil
The discussion of proposals comes against a backdrop of serious marital issues. Olivia has recently hinted at infidelity within her marriage, urging women to come forward with their experiences via social media. She shared an emotional post, writing, 'And reading "hey girly" texts on my break, gals come to the front today please and then I'm moving on with my life ty x', alongside a tearful selfie.
Sources indicate that the split was triggered by Bradley's alleged cheating, with Olivia reportedly finding evidence on his phone. A friend revealed, 'She was trying to respect their ten-year relationship by staying quiet but her friends are bemused as to how Bradley is the one who caused all this, and Liv was still trying to protect him.'

Reflections on a Decade-Long Relationship
Olivia and Bradley announced their engagement in October 2019, after four years of an on-off relationship. She shared joyful Instagram snaps from Dubai, flashing a pear-shaped diamond ring. However, the couple's decade-long relationship has been marred by rumours of infidelity, ultimately leading to their separation.
In a heartfelt social media post, Olivia expressed her struggle, writing, 'I cry myself to sleep, then business as normal when the alarm goes off at 5am and it has been like that for a long time.' She added a message of hope, saying, 'I want to be happy. I want Brad to be happy. Just one day at a time.'
